当前位置: 首页 > news >正文

交换机端口安全

端口安全

  • 端口安全(PortSecurity)通过将接口学习到的动态MAC地址转换为安全MAC地址(包括安全动态MAC、安全静态MAC和Sticky MAC),阻止非法用户通过本接口和交换机通信,从而增强设备的安全性。

1、安全mac地址分类

  • 安全动态MAC地址:接口启用端口安全后,学习到的MAC地址都为安全动态MAC地址,默认学习到的没有老化时间,设备重启后需要重新学习(交换机接口没有启用端口安全,学习到的MAC地址默认是有老化时间的)
  • 安全静态MAC地址:接口启用端口安全后,手动绑定的MAC地址
  • StickyMAC地址:接口启用端口安全后并配置sticky特性,可以实现自动绑定MAC地址。绑定的MAC地址设备重启后也不会丢失。
    • 在网络正常情况下连接主机的接口启用端口并配置sticky特性,再结合端口上最大MAC地址的活跃数量来阻止非法主机连接本机口和交换机通信(因为一般情况下,交换机连接主机的端口只会有一个MAC地址)

2、实验操作

1745162637809

  • kali上实施mac泛洪,生成虚假的源MAC地址发送报文到交换机,使交换机学习大量的虚假MAC地址,将交换机的MAC地址表占满,从而交换机后续转发正常的用户流量都会采用广播方式发送,kali就可以截获到对应流量

    #在kali中输入,实现Mac泛红
    macof
    
  • 当华为交换机上启用了端口安全后,默认的接口可以学习的安全MAC地址为1个,其他主机发送的流量检测到MAC地址为不安全MAC地址,从而流量全部限制(默认动作)

#启用端口安全
<Huawei>sys
[Huawei]int g0/0/10
[Huawei-GigabitEthernet0/0/10]port-security enable #sticky 特性地址
[Huawei-GigabitEthernet0/0/10]port-security mac-address sticky #配置接口可以学习的MAC地址最大数量
[Huawei-GigabitEthernet0/0/10]port-security max-mac-num 4#配置当接口出现违规流量后的动作
[Huawei-GigabitEthernet0/0/10]port-security protect-action [protect|restrict|shutdown]
#protect:丢弃不告警
#restrict:丢弃并告警
#shutdown:直接将物理接口关闭
http://www.xdnf.cn/news/46495.html

相关文章:

  • C++学习之游戏服务器开发⑩ZINX的TCP通道实现
  • 基于 Vue3 + ECharts + GeoJson 实现区域地图钻取功能详解
  • 大模型在胆管结石(无胆管炎或胆囊炎)预测及治疗方案制定中的应用研究
  • 【perf】perf工具的使用生成火焰图
  • 自由的控件开发平台:飞帆中使用 css 和 js 库
  • 如何优雅地实现全局唯一?深入理解单例模式
  • uniapp微信小程序实现sse
  • 深度学习优化器详解:SGD、Adam与AdamW
  • C#/.NET/.NET Core技术前沿周刊 | 第 35 期(2025年4.14-4.20)
  • docker 安装 MySQL
  • 【Oracle专栏】函数中SQL拼接参数 报错处理
  • 【网络原理】TCP协议如何实现可靠传输(确认应答和超时重传机制)
  • Vue3 + TypeScript,关于item[key]的报错处理方法
  • Cherry Studio配置MCP服务全流程解析
  • AIGC通信架构深度优化指南
  • C++在VR/AR图形处理开发中的实战应用
  • 02【初体验】安装、配置与 Hello Cargo:踏出 Rust 开发第一步
  • Lora 微调自定义device_map
  • 【Linux】Rhcsa复习5
  • 阿里云 dataworks maxcompute创建python脚本实现列转行 脚本demo示例。
  • 06 GE Modifier
  • AUTOSAR图解==>AUTOSAR_RS_BSWModuleDescriptionTemplate
  • 19. git reflog
  • 力扣每日打卡16 781. 森林中的兔子(中等)
  • C++项目 —— 基于多设计模式下的同步异步日志系统(4)(双缓冲区异步任务处理器(AsyncLooper)设计)
  • 家庭电脑隐身后台自动截屏软件,可远程查看
  • Spring Data MongoDB 精华:给新手的核心注解指南
  • 从内核到用户态:Linux信号内核结构、保存与处理全链路剖析
  • 图论基础:图存+记忆化搜索
  • 基于论文的大模型应用:基于SmartETL的arXiv论文数据接入与预处理(三)